use crate::into::IntoResponse;
use std::path::Path;
use std::convert::AsRef;
use tokio::{io, fs};
use http::header::Mime;
use http::{Response, Body};
pub struct File {
file: fs::File,
mime_type: Mime,
size: usize
}
impl File {
pub fn new<M>(file: fs::File, mime_type: M, size: usize) -> Self
where M: Into<Mime> {
Self { file, mime_type: mime_type.into(), size }
}
pub async fn open<P>(path: P) -> io::Result<Self>
where P: AsRef<Path> {
let extension = path.as_ref()
.extension()
.and_then( |f| f.to_str() );
let mime_type = match extension {
Some(e) => Mime::from_ext(e),
None => Mime::Binary
};
let file = fs::File::open( path ).await?;
let metadata = file.metadata().await?;
if !metadata.is_file() {
return Err(io::Error::new(
io::ErrorKind::NotFound,
"expected file found folder"
))
}
let size = metadata.len() as usize;
Ok( Self {
file, mime_type, size
} )
}
}
impl IntoResponse for File {
fn into_response(self) -> Response {
Response::builder()
.content_type(self.mime_type)
.header("content-length", self.size)
.body(Body::from_async_read(self.file))
.build()
}
}
